Mitsubishi MELSEC-Q Series Simple Motion Module is a versatile solution for precise positioning and motion control in industrial automation applications. It offers a range of features and capabilities that make it suitable for a variety of tasks.
Lineup
Number of axes | CC-Link IE Field | SSCNETⅢ/H |
---|---|---|
2 | — | QD77MS2 |
4 | QD77GF4 | QD77MS4 |
8 | QD77GF8 | — |
16 | QD77GF16 | QD77MS16 |
Features
- Positioning control:The module can accurately control the position of servo motors, allowing for precise movements and positioning of equipment.
- Synchronous control: It enables synchronized motion between multiple axes, which is essential for applications requiring coordinated movement, such as robotics and material handling.
- Speed/torque control: In addition to positioning control, the module also supports speed and torque control, providing flexibility for different application requirements.
- Easy setup and programming: The module comes with a user-friendly “simple motion module setting tool” that simplifies the process of configuring, monitoring, and debugging motion control operations.
- Network connectivity: The module supports various network interfaces, including CC-Link IE Field Network, allowing for seamless integration with other automation components.

The simple motion module supports the general purpose CC-Link IE Field Network, with its flexible wiring. This module can be used as the CC-Link IE Field’s master station*1 while retaining the simple motion module’s functions. This realizes flexible networking supporting connection to various devices such as GOT(HMI), remote I/O, inverter, etc.
- *1.QD77GF4, QD77GF8, QD77GF16 master station transmission style can use the line type or star type. Up to 104 remote devices can be connected to one network.

General specifications SSCNETⅢ/H connection type:
QD77MS2 | QD77MS4 | QD77MS16 | ||
---|---|---|---|---|
Maximum number of control axes | 2-axes | 4-axes | 16-axes | |
Servo amplifier connection method | SSCNETⅢ/H | |||
Maximum distance between stations | 100 m | |||
Control system | PTP (Point to Point) control, path control (both linear and arc can be set), speed control, speed/position switching control, position/speed switching control, speed-torque control (press-fit control), synchronous control, electronic cam control, torque control, tightening & press-fit control | |||

The SSCNETⅢ/H connection reduces wiring, enables connections of up to 100 m between stations, and easily supports absolute position settings. The upper limit LS, lower limit LS, and near-point dog signals can be input from the servo amplifier, thus greatly reducing wiring. In addition to positioning control and speed control, processes such as synchronous control and electronic cam control can be performed.
